I changed the plugs and pcv valve and cleaned up the contacts on the cap and rotor. It still failed for CO. I told the inspector to do what was needed to pass. He eventually got it through by adjusting the carb but he did say the carb should be rebuilt. It's brand new! When I drove the Soob away it ran like crap. Upon further inspection at home I found the timing retarded and vacuum hoses off. I timed her and replaced the hoses; she runs like brand new. This is an '87 GL with a E82 engine. I did find that there is a problem with non Soob PCV valves. It's best to go OEM on this minor part. Thanks to the person who brought that to my attention.
